Oklahoma football has a rich history that includes 116 seasons of triumphs, from Bud Wilkinson and Billy Vessels to Danny Stutsman and Brent Venables. The Sooners have won 49 conference titles and six national championships and produced seven Heisman Trophy winners in nearly 12 decades. The team’s iconic crimson and cream uniforms have remained unchanged over the years. Recently, the Sooners announced new alternate uniforms inspired by the 1950s, a decade in which Oklahoma won three titles.

According to the team’s official Twitter page, Oklahoma football will be wearing a new third jersey this season. The Sooners first introduced their crimson third jerseys with cream accents and trim in 2014.

The Oklahoma football team will sport a new look for its Sept. 7 game against the Houston Cougars to start the season. According to its official Twitter page, the now SEC-affiliated team will wear primarily red, 1950s-style uniforms for its second home game against Houston. The uniforms will feature white horizontal stripes on the sleeves, while the helmet will feature the same white base and red stripes from the 1950s. Oklahoma’s announcement was accompanied by an epic hype video that included a snippet of longtime head coach Bud Wilkinson.

“In Norman, Oklahoma, coach Bud Wilkinson’s Sooners were polishing their 1951 Big 7 championship crown when the 1952 season began. Bud Wilkinson had a number of splinter-like Sooners. Speedy left guard Billy Vessels was awarded the Heisman Trophy.”

“Our team has worked very hard in training and we are just waiting until the game to see what kind of team we have.”

According to Soonersports, “Oklahoma’s 2024 third jersey is representative of the jersey worn by OU teams from 1946-1956.” The Sooners were a powerhouse during that era, winning three of their seven titles and finishing in the top 25 of the AP poll every season.

Oklahoma football will honor Hall of Fame head coach Bud Wilkinson with its 2024 alternate jerseys. Wilkinson, an assistant coach at Oklahoma in 1946, took over the following season after his predecessor Jim Tatum left to fill the vacant head coaching position at Maryland football. Wilkinson spent his entire 17-year college football head coaching career with the Sooners, compiling an incredible 145-29 record.

In Oklahoma’s third season under Wilkinson’s leadership, the Sooners posted a perfect 11-0 record and finished with a 35-0 win in the Sugar Bowl over LSU. OU won its first of three titles under Wilkinson the following season despite a 10-1 record. Wilkinson’s best stretch was from 1954-56, when the Sooners posted a 31-0 record and won two titles. The 1956 Sooners allowed just 13 points in their final six games and led the country with 33 points scored per game.
